The LTC3406BES5-1.5#TRPBF is a high-efficiency, monolithic synchronous buck regulator designed by Analog Devices. It operates from an input voltage range of 2.5V to 5.5V and delivers a fixed output voltage of 1.5V. The device is optimized for portable devices, offering low quiescent current and high efficiency across a wide load range.
High Efficiency: With efficiencies up to 95%, the LTC3406BES5-1.5#TRPBF ensures minimal power loss, enhancing battery life.
Low Quiescent Current: The device consumes only 30μA of quiescent current, making it suitable for battery-operated applications.
Compact Package: It is available in a tiny 5-lead ThinSOT package, saving valuable board space.
Stable Operation: The LTC3406BES5-1.5#TRPBF offers excellent line and load regulation, ensuring stable output under varying conditions.
Wide Input Voltage Range: Operates from 2.5V to 5.5V, supporting a variety of input sources including single-cell Li-Ion batteries.
The primary function of the LTC3406BES5-1.5#TRPBF is to step down higher input voltages to a stable 1.5V output with high efficiency. It integrates both high-side and low-side MOSFETs, which reduces the need for external components and minimizes power loss. The device uses a constant frequency, current mode architecture, providing fast transient response and ease of loop compensation.
Performance-wise, the regulator achieves up to 95% efficiency, significantly extending the runtime of battery-powered devices. Its low output ripple and noise make it suitable for sensitive electronic systems.
Given its specifications and performance, the LTC3406BES5-1.5#TRPBF is ideal for various applications, including:
Portable Electronics: Smartphones, PDAs, and other handheld devices benefit from its high efficiency and compact size.
Battery-Powered Systems: Its low quiescent current makes it perfect for applications where battery life is critical.
Wireless Communication Devices: Ensures stable voltage supply for RF circuits and processors.
Embedded Systems: Suitable for powering microcontrollers and other digital logic circuits.
